CHF Announces Matching Gift Challenge
California Homebuilding Foundation Trustee Michael Cortney has announced that a matching gift of $25,000 will be made to the Foundation if it can secure pledges totaling $25,000 or greater.
This springtime fundraising campaign will assist in the Foundation’s scholarship and research programs. To know you are supporting important industry programs and making your gift receive double the impact, is a significant plus in today’s current economy.
CHF has a resource for in-depth studies that local BIAs and HBAs have used in discussion with local agencies, including Water Use in the California Residential Home – January 2010; Economic Benefits of Housing 2008; and Meeting AB32 - Housing Retrofit Study 2007.
Other recent studies by CHF include New Housing Construction Economic Impact 2009; Youth Employment Manual 2008; The Housing Bottom Line - Fiscal Impacts 2007; Latino Homebuyer Study 2007; California's Right to Repair - SB800 2007.
